An efficient methodology for cryopreservation of spermatozoa of red seabream, Pagrus major, with 2-mL cryovials.

摘要

The aim of this study was to optimize the cryopreservation protocols for the sperm of red sea bream, P. major. The 2-ml cryovials and programmable freezer were employed for cryopreservation. Six extenders, six cryoprotectants in various concentrations ranging from 6-20% (v/v), four cooling rates and three thawing temperatures were evaluated by postthaw sperm motility and fertility. The ratio of sperm to egg for postthaw sperm fertilization trials was experimentally standardized and was optimal at 500:1. The best motility of postthaw sperm (79.4+or-4.7% to 88.6+or-8.0%), fertilization rates (89.6+or-2.9 to 95.6+or-1.9%) and hatching rates (85.3+or-5.1% to 91.4+or-4.3%) were achieved when Cortland extender, dimethyl sulfoxide (15, 18 and 20%) or ethylene glycol (9 and 12%) as cryoprotectants, 20 degrees C/min as the cooling rate and 40 degrees C as the thawing temperature were employed. Moreover, the results on embryonic development were not significantly different between cryopreserved sperm and fresh sperm during incubation process. In conclusion, these methods of cryopreservation of red sea bream sperm are suitable for routine aquaculture application and preservation of genetic resources..
